    Banks never ask you to move your funds. Especially when the account is held by another bank. When you get text messages like that always call the bank using the phone number on the website. It is not the bank’s responsibility - you have to be vigilant.

    Any COLD CALLS or texts or anything, you directly contact your bank!, never use the information they provide! Banks do not cold call, the scammers prey on you believing them as they have good details.. your details are available everywhere!
